    Republicans are jumping in quickly to replace retiring U.S. Rep. Mike Rogers, who announced Friday he’ll be leaving Congress at the end of the year to be a talk radio host. Mike Bishop, former majority leader in the Michigan Senate, confirmed Monday he’ll be in the running. And Rochester Hills Mayor Bryan K. Barnett has set up a page on the social media site Facebook to push his own candidacy. Bishop, an attorney and Rochester Republican, said via the social media platform Twitter that he’ll seek the seat. “Yes sir,” Bishop tweeted in response to a direct message Monday morning....

    Lawmaker takes stand against millage election By Christopher Nagy DAILY PRESS & ARGUS State Rep. Joe Hune, R-Hamburg Township, has already come out against the May 3 enhancement millage, but he is now coming out against the election itself. Hune, who supported the election consolidation plan that reduced the number of elections in the state to four specific dates, eliminating the standard school election held each June, said school districts in Livingston County made a mistake by opting to hold their elections on the date in May provided under the consolidation.
